Which accounting software should you choose in Belgium in 2026?

Since 1 January 2026, the first question to ask of accounting software in Belgium is no longer its price but its ability to issue and receive invoices over the Peppol network. The Belgian market splits into three families that are often confused: practice software, accounting and invoicing solutions for SMEs, and the exchange components that feed the first two. The right choice depends first of all on who keeps your books.

Is electronic invoicing mandatory in Belgium in 2026?

Yes. Since 1 January 2026, every VAT-registered business established in Belgium must issue and receive structured electronic invoices for its B2B transactions with other Belgian taxable persons, over the Peppol network. The tolerance period covering the first three months of 2026 ended in April 2026. Certain categories remain outside the scope, notably taxable persons exempt under article 44 of the VAT Code.
